Adjective

edit

cringeworthy (comparative more cringeworthy, superlative most cringeworthy)

  1. (colloquial) That causes one to cringe with embarrassment; embarrassing.
    • 2022 May 4, Stefanie Foster, “Great British Rail Sale failed!”, in RAIL, number 956, page 3:
      It also presented a golden opportunity for Transport Secretary Grant Shapps to wear silly outfits and produce yet another cringeworthy video, which attracted sharp criticism online.
